Job description

Job Summary

Under general supervision, the Office Coordinator is responsible for ensuring an outstanding guest experience by serving as the primary point of contact for welcoming guests to the facility. Additionally, the Office Coordinator will be responsible for answering phone calls, receiving mail and packages, and performing other support tasks for the management team and hourly team members.

Job Description
M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Serve as the initial contact for greeting visitors, logging guest visits, and alerting the appropriate party of the visitor's arrival.
  • Help direct and/or escort visitors to appropriate Medline meeting room/destination.
  • Complete security procedures (e.g., issues badges to new team members, ensures proper completion of visitors' log).
  • Assist in maintaining office and breakroom cleanliness and ordering office and breakroom supplies when needed.
  • Assist team members with travel-related inquiries, employee purchases, employee shipments, and distributing of apparel.
  • Process expense reports for management team and hourly team members.
  • Follow record retention guidelines to scan and retain non-sensitive team member documents.
  • Maintain communication boards, location contact list, and Operations News Network Content with information and content supplied by the management team.
  • Answer incoming calls in a professional and courteous manner. Direct callers to appropriate parties or departments for all Medline locations.
  • Receive and direct all deliveries, including, food, printing, and flowers. Contact applicable employee upon delivery.
  • Assist in maintaining facility safety by alerting security of any suspicious activity.
  • Provide professional, accurate, and timely support to visitors and employees.
